Who pays for painting in a rented home in Italy?
Generally speaking, the cost of repainting a rented property depends on what caused the walls to deteriorate, or on any agreement made between the parties. The basic rule on who pays for painting in a rented home is based on normal deterioration over time. The landlord is responsible for ordinary wear and tear, such as yellowing walls or marks caused by structural damp. The tenant only has to pay for repairs when deterioration results from improper use of the property or their own negligence.
